An Awareness Programme on Drug Abuse, Tobacco and Cyber Crime was organized at St. Xavier's Higher Secondary School, Pathaliaghat on 22nd May 2026 from 11:00 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. in the school assembly hall for the students of Classes VI to XII. The programme was conducted by Shri Jayanta Dubey with the aim of creating awareness among students regarding the growing dangers of substance abuse and cyber-related crimes. During the session, Shri Jayanta Dubey spoke in detail about the harmful effects of drug abuse and tobacco consumption on physical health, mental well-being, family life, and society. He also sensitized the students on the dangers of cyber crime, online fraud, cyber bullying, misuse of social media, and the importance of responsible digital behaviour.
